The third milestone in the history of the use of fermentation products in agriculture was the discovery of the avermectins. They were first detected in an anthelmintic assay using mice infected with nematospiroides dubius (13). This is one of the few assays in which they could have been detected since they lack antibacterial and antifungal activity. [Pg.68]

The avermectins were initially detected in a program in which thousands of microbial fermentation products were tested in mice for activity against the nematode, Nematospiroides dubius. [Pg.5]

The nematode, Nematospiroides dubius, was selected for the assay. Infected mice were fed for six days with milled Purina Lab Chow which had been mixed with the fermentation product to be tested. The mice were then fed a normal diet and, at 14 days postinfection, fecal pellets were examined for the presence of eggs. If eggs were absent on three successive days, the mice were sacrificed and their small intestines examined for the presence of worms. [Pg.6]

Still other types of activity are claimed for oxadiazole derivatives. For example, compound 131 is an anthelmintic against Nematospiroides dubius in mice, dogs, and sheep.31,210-212 Compound 132 is a local anaesthetic and has antispasmodic and anti-inflammatory activity.205,206,213,214 The sulfa drug 133 is said to be comparable in... [Pg.113]
